Remote Otter LogoRemoteOtter

Social Media & Community Manager - Remote

Posted 1 week ago
Marketing
Full Time
Worldwide

Overview

This role is part of our Growth marketing team. We deliver end to end data driven campaigns which foster both creativity and performance. Our specialty is creative, digital communications that drives performance, boost brand awareness, and shift market share for our clients including eBay, Douglas, Aldi, Smart, and more!

In Short

  • Enhance brand awareness across multiple channels.
  • Plan and manage social media campaigns.
  • Create and publish engaging content.
  • Manage community interactions and responses.
  • Collaborate with production teams for social content.
  • Write compelling copy tailored to target audiences.
  • Use social media management tools effectively.
  • Participate in weekly internal and client meetings.
  • Contribute to the overall creative strategy.
  • Drive engagement and brand positioning.

Requirements

  • Proven experience in organic social media management.
  • Strong proficiency in English (written and spoken).
  • Excellent copywriting skills.
  • Familiarity with social media management tools.
  • Strong organizational skills.
  • Creative mindset with an understanding of trends.
  • Ability to manage multiple projects simultaneously.
  • Presenting skills.
  • Experience in community management.
  • Ability to write engaging copy.

Benefits

  • Hybrid working policy.
  • Referral bonus program.
  • Health contributions and private health insurance.
  • Opportunities for training and development.
  • Participation in global charity events.
  • Work with diverse clients and industries.
  • Inclusive workplace culture.
  • Support for personal growth and autonomy.
  • Recognition as a Certified B Corp®.
  • Celebration of team successes.
Dept logo

Dept

DEPT® is a pioneering technology and marketing services company that specializes in creating integrated end-to-end digital experiences for renowned brands such as Google, KFC, Philips, Audi, Twitch, Patagonia, and eBay. With a team of over 2,500 digital specialists across more than 30 locations on five continents, DEPT® combines a global reach with a boutique culture, fostering innovation and collaboration. The company is committed to personal and professional growth, offering a supportive environment that values diversity, equity, and inclusion. As a B Corp-certified organization, DEPT® is dedicated to purpose-driven work, ensuring that its contributions positively impact the world.

Share This Job!

Save This Job!

Similar Jobs:

Lokalise

Community & Social Media Manager - Remote

Lokalise

4 weeks ago

Lokalise is seeking a Community & Social Media Manager to enhance their social presence and community engagement.

Worldwide
Full-time
Marketing
SLAY logo

Community & Social Media Manager - Remote

SLAY

4 weeks ago

Join SLAY as a Community & Social Media Manager to create engaging content and foster community relationships.

Germany
Full-time
Marketing
Fictiv logo

Social Media & Community Manager - Remote

Fictiv

5 weeks ago

Fictiv is seeking a Social Media & Community Manager to enhance their online presence and engage with technical communities.

USA
Full-time
Marketing
$80,000 - $115,000/year
Later logo

Community Manager / Social Media Manager - Remote

Later

5 weeks ago

Join Later as a Community Manager / Social Media Manager to create engaging content and manage client relationships in a dynamic social media environment.

USA
Full-time
Marketing
$89,000 - $98,000 USD/year
Later logo

Community Manager / Social Media Manager - Remote

Later

5 weeks ago

Join Later as a Community Manager / Social Media Manager to enhance content creation and community engagement for various clients.

USA
Contract
Marketing